A withdrawal device, also known as a retracting device, is a crucial component utilized in various industries for different applications. This versatile tool is designed to withdraw or retract certain materials, products, or objects from a specific location or process. The primary function of a withdrawal device is to ensure the safe and efficient removal of materials without causing damage to the product or the surrounding environment.
One of the most common uses of a withdrawal device is in the manufacturing industry. In manufacturing processes, products often need to be withdrawn or removed from machines or production lines at different stages of the manufacturing process. A withdrawal device can help automate this process, reducing the need for manual labor and ensuring that products are safely removed without any mishaps.
For example, in the food and beverage industry, a withdrawal device is often used to remove bottles or cans from conveyor belts once they have been filled and sealed. This helps streamline the production process and ensures that products are efficiently removed from the production line without causing any damage to the packaging or contents.
In the pharmaceutical industry, withdrawal devices are commonly used to remove vials, syringes, or other medical supplies from automated production lines. This is essential to maintain the integrity of the products and ensure that they are safely removed from the production process without any contamination.
